In the context of Athens College High School's participation in the European Program "European Parliament Ambassadors Schools" (EPAS), one of the main activities organized was the simulation of a meeting of the European Parliament at the Choremi Theater.

In cooperation with the members of the MUN Club, the Junior Ambassadors of the European Parliament were responsible for the preparation and conduct of the simulation, the main theme of which was the fight against global climate change and preventive measures to protect the environment.

More specifically, on Monday, April 1, 2024, students divided into groups corresponding to the political groups of the European Parliament and debated on two proposals to tackle rising sea levels in the Netherlands, which poses risks for many countries in the European Union. Following the procedures of a session of the European Parliament, the two proposals were presented by the representatives of the groups, followed by a debate on the individual points and finally the process was concluded by the vote on the proposals.

The aim of the action was to familiarize the pupils with the functioning of an institution of the European Union, the European Parliament, and to understand, through teamwork, its central role in taking legislative initiatives to deal with important issues affecting European citizens' lives.
